JS效果大全(以静态页面展示)
JavaScript(简称JS)是一种广泛应用于Web开发的轻量级编程语言,主要负责网页的动态交互。在"JS效果大全(以静态页面展示)"这个压缩包中,我们可以期待找到一系列使用JavaScript实现的视觉效果,这些效果通常通过HTML静态页面来呈现。下面将详细探讨一些可能包含在这些效果中的JavaScript知识点。 1. DOM操作:JavaScript与HTML文档对象模型(DOM)紧密相连,允许开发者动态修改网页内容。例如,可以添加、删除或修改HTML元素,改变文本、样式、属性等。 2. 事件处理:JS通过监听和响应用户或浏览器触发的事件,如点击、滚动、键盘输入等,实现交互性。例如,点击按钮弹出提示框,或者页面加载完成后执行某些操作。 3. 动画效果:JavaScript可以用来创建平滑的动画效果,如淡入淡出、滑动、旋转等。这通常通过改变元素的位置、大小、透明度等属性实现。 4. AJAX异步通信:AJAX允许在不刷新整个页面的情况下与服务器交换数据并更新部分网页内容。这对于实现无刷新的用户体验至关重要,如实时聊天、动态加载数据等。 5. jQuery库:jQuery是广泛使用的JS库,简化了DOM操作、事件处理和动画等功能。如果压缩包中包含jQuery示例,那么可能会看到更简洁的代码和丰富的效果。 6. Canvas绘图:HTML5的Canvas元素提供了在网页上进行图形绘制的能力,JavaScript可以用来控制Canvas,实现游戏、图表、动态图像等复杂效果。 7. Web API利用:JavaScript可以调用浏览器提供的各种Web API,如Geolocation获取用户位置、WebSocket实现双向通信、Fetch API进行HTTP请求等。 8. 函数和闭包:理解函数和闭包是掌握JavaScript的关键。函数可以封装代码,而闭包则允许函数访问和操作其外部作用域的变量,常用于实现私有变量和模块化。 9. 数据结构与算法:JS支持数组、对象等多种数据结构,以及常见的排序、查找算法。熟练运用这些知识可以优化代码性能和效果。 10. ES6新特性:压缩包中可能包含使用ES6(ECMAScript 2015)语法的示例,如箭头函数、模板字符串、解构赋值、类和模块等,这些都是现代JavaScript开发的重要组成部分。 每个HTML静态页面都可能是一个独立的JS效果展示,通过分析和学习这些页面,开发者可以提升对JavaScript实际应用的理解,增强自己的前端开发技能。无论是初学者还是经验丰富的开发者,都能从这个"JS效果大全"中获益。
- 1
- 2
- 3
- 4
- 5
- 6
- 11
- 粉丝: 31
- 资源: 34
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
- 1
- 2
- 3
前往页